Patents by Inventor Michael R. Dunlavey

Michael R. Dunlavey has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 6985846
    Abstract: A system and method for simulating clinical trial protocols with compiled state machines is presented. The system receives input data representing a clinical trial protocol. This information is sorted into a plurality of schedules, including dosage schedules, observation schedules, and various other types of schedules. The schedules are translated into a general purpose high level programming language and then compiled into and executable file. The executable file may comprise a plurality of discrete state machines, each state machine corresponding directly to a single schedule. During the clinical trial simulation, the executable file is run by the trial simulator to simulate the trial protocol.
    Type: Grant
    Filed: March 30, 2001
    Date of Patent: January 10, 2006
    Assignee: Pharsight Corporation
    Inventor: Michael R. Dunlavey
  • Patent number: 6937257
    Abstract: A method for maintaining consistent unit relationships during graphical pharmacological computational model construction is disclosed. A graphical user interface is presented through which a user may place and connect objects representing pharmacokinetic and pharmacodynamic elements. The user may specify units definitions for variables and constants using unit expressions. As the objects are converted into an internal format representing the statements of the corresponding computational model, the unit expressions are included in this internal format as multidimensional data type information. This multidimensional data type information is regularly and automatically propagated for each statement in the internal format to identify inconsistent units. When such inconsistent units are identified, a warning message is generated to notify the user, substantially immediately after the inconsistent units are created.
    Type: Grant
    Filed: March 30, 2001
    Date of Patent: August 30, 2005
    Assignee: Pharsight Corporation
    Inventor: Michael R. Dunlavey